New Delhi: The National Medical Commission (NMC) has asked the National Board of Examinations (NCB) to reduce the cut-off mark for NEET PG 2021, the entrance exam for postgraduate medical courses, by 15 percent. The decision was taken against the backdrop of 8,000 vacant seats after two phases of allotment. The Medical Commission also directed the Board to prepare the revised examination results as soon as possible.
